The controller is designed for installation in an enclosure which provides adequate
protection against electric shock. Local regulations regarding electrical installation
should be rigidly observed. Consideration should be given to prevention of access
to the Power Supply terminals by unauthorized personnel.

DC Linear Current / Voltage Output
The DC Linear (0/4-20 mA) Current or (0-5/10 V) Voltage output is also available at Terminal 6 (+)
and Terminal 4 (-) if the Output-1 is configured for DC Linear.

The Output-2 and Output-3 are available through plug-in modules. The modules are factory configured for either Relay / SSR
or DC Linear Voltage or DC Linear Current. The connection descriptions are the same as those described for Output-1.
POWER SUPPLY
(Terminals : 12, 13)
Figure 12.4
As standard, the controller is supplied with power connections suited for 85 to 264 VAC. Use well-insulated copper conductor
2
wire of the size not smaller than 0.5mm for connections. Connect Line (Phase) to terminal 12 and the Neutral (Return) to
terminal 13 as shown in Figure 12.4. The controller is not provided with fuse and power switch. If necessary, mount them
separately. Use a time lag fuse rated 1A @ 240 VAC.
For DC Supply, connect Signal (+) & Common (-) to controller terminals 12 & 13, respectively.
SERIAL COMMUNICATION PORT
(Terminals : 14 , 15)
(Applicable if the Option plug-in module for RS485 Serial Port is fitted.)
Figure 12.5
If the Optional plug-in communication board is fitted, connect terminal 15 and 14 of the controller to (+) and (-) terminals of the
Master device.
For reliable noise free communication, use a pair of twisted wires inside screened cable as shown in Figure
12.5. The wire should have less than 100 ohms / km nominal DC resistance (typically 24 AWG or thicker). Connect the
terminating resistor (typically 100 to 150 ohm) at one end to improve noise immunity.
